-- | Replace the result 'Type' of a function with a new 'Type'.
type family ReplaceHandler server replacement where
ReplaceHandler (a :<|> b) replacement = ReplaceHandler a replacement :<|> ReplaceHandler b replacement
ReplaceHandler (a -> b) replacement = a -> ReplaceHandler b replacement
ReplaceHandler _ replacement = replacement
-- | Create all 'ResourceLink's to a 'Layer's 'RelativeChildren'.
type BuildLayerLinks :: Layer -> (Type -> Type) -> Constraint
class BuildLayerLinks l m where
buildLayerLinks :: MonadIO m => Proxy l -> Proxy m -> ReplaceHandler (ServerT l m) [(String, ResourceLink)]
